On 23-12-18 14:14:18, Xu Yang wrote:
> Some platform using ChipIdea IP may keep 32KHz wakeup clock always
> on without usb driver intervention. And some may need driver to handle
> this clock. For now only i.MX93 needs this wakeup clock. This patch will
> get wakeup clock and keep it always on to make controller work properly.

> diff --git a/drivers/usb/chipidea/ci_hdrc_imx.c b/drivers/usb/chipidea/ci_hdrc_imx.c
> index e28bb2f2612d..4330be8240ff 100644
> --- a/drivers/usb/chipidea/ci_hdrc_imx.c
> +++ b/drivers/usb/chipidea/ci_hdrc_imx.c
> @@ -96,6 +96,7 @@ struct ci_hdrc_imx_data {
> struct usb_phy *phy;
> struct platform_device *ci_pdev;
> struct clk *clk;
> + struct clk *clk_wakeup;
> struct imx_usbmisc_data *usbmisc_data;
> bool supports_runtime_pm;
> bool override_phy_control;
> @@ -199,7 +200,7 @@ static int imx_get_clks(struct device *dev)
>
> data->clk_ipg = devm_clk_get(dev, "ipg");
> if (IS_ERR(data->clk_ipg)) {
> - /* If the platform only needs one clocks */
> + /* If the platform only needs one primary clock */
> data->clk = devm_clk_get(dev, NULL);
> if (IS_ERR(data->clk)) {
> ret = PTR_ERR(data->clk);
> @@ -208,6 +209,18 @@ static int imx_get_clks(struct device *dev)
> PTR_ERR(data->clk), PTR_ERR(data->clk_ipg));
> return ret;
> }
> + /* Get wakeup clock. Not all of the platforms need to
> + * handle this clock. So make it optional.
> + */
> + data->clk_wakeup = devm_clk_get_optional(dev,
> + "usb_wakeup_clk");
> + if (IS_ERR(data->clk_wakeup)) {
> + ret = PTR_ERR(data->clk_wakeup);
> + dev_err(dev,
> + "Failed to get wakeup clk, err=%ld\n",
> + PTR_ERR(data->clk_wakeup));
> + return ret;
> + }
> return ret;
> }
>
> @@ -423,6 +436,10 @@ static int ci_hdrc_imx_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
> if (ret)
> goto disable_hsic_regulator;
>
> + ret = clk_prepare_enable(data->clk_wakeup);
> + if (ret)
> + goto err_wakeup_clk;
> +
> data->phy = devm_usb_get_phy_by_phandle(dev, "fsl,usbphy", 0);
> if (IS_ERR(data->phy)) {
> ret = PTR_ERR(data->phy);
> @@ -504,6 +521,8 @@ static int ci_hdrc_imx_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
> disable_device:
> ci_hdrc_remove_device(data->ci_pdev);
> err_clk:
> + clk_disable_unprepare(data->clk_wakeup);
> +err_wakeup_clk:
> imx_disable_unprepare_clks(dev);
> disable_hsic_regulator:
> if (data->hsic_pad_regulator)
> @@ -530,6 +549,7 @@ static void ci_hdrc_imx_remove(struct platform_device *pdev)
> usb_phy_shutdown(data->phy);
> if (data->ci_pdev) {
> imx_disable_unprepare_clks(&pdev->dev);
> + clk_disable_unprepare(data->clk_wakeup);
> if (data->plat_data->flags & CI_HDRC_PMQOS)
> cpu_latency_qos_remove_request(&data->pm_qos_req);
> if (data->hsic_pad_regulator)
